Trust Fighter Free Removal

There are plenty of infections probably residing at your computer system, but none of them would be mentioned in the scan by Trust Fighter (TrustFighter). In fact, the scan by Trust Fighter is not a scan at all as a scan implies monitoring objects in the memory of a PC concerned while there is no such monitoring during the process posed by Trust Fighter as its scan. Remove Trust Fighter as a sort of scareware, which only aim is to scare you into paying the appropriate activation fee. Its scan is just a show in which all names of infections are fabricated.
Trust Fighter removal, if you are going to get rid of Trust Fighter scam entirely, requires that you delete every relevant Trust Fighter entry. Remove TrustCop that lies

TrustCop lies when it names the infections it has found as those infections are neither harmless nor useful entries. TrustCop creates them itself for a meticulous user could make sure they do exist. Sometimes it concocts a blend of names just made up by jackers and names made up by them and used to denominate the above neither harmless nor useful entries. Remove TrustCop as a true infection.
The rogue is a clone that belongs to one of the biggest, if not the biggest, family of fake antispyware clones. It is propagated with trojan. The trojan automatically uploads and installs TrustCop and also hijack web-browser settings to popup TrustCop ads. Users are eager to get rid of TrustCop due to its annoying way of reminding them that they need to pay the activation fee to get its full-fledged version, but they do not realize the need to remove TrustCop as its activities affect host system and often result in slow computer problem.
